Business Registration Certificate Definition. A business registration certificate is an official document issued by a government authority that confirms a companys legal existence and compliance with local regulations, allowing it to operate and engage in business activities.
MyTax Illinois is the primary method you should use to obtain and print a copy of your Certificate of Registration or License. From your MyTax Account, the Certificate of Registration or License is located by selecting View more account options and then View Account Letters in the Letters and Messages panel.
The certificate issued by the USPTO stating that a trademark has officially been registered.
If you have not registered but are required to have this certificate, you will need to complete Form NJ-REG. Representatives of the Divisions Client Registration activity are available to assist in the registration process by calling 609.292. 9292. In most cases, you may submit Form NJ-REG online.
The Certificate of Registration and validation decal are issued by the Florida Department of Highway Safety and Motor Vehicles. The registration and decal are obtained by submitting the proper application and fee to your county tax collectors office.

A Certificate of Registration or License allows you to do business in the State of Illinois as a retailer, reseller, or provider of services or goods that makes you responsible for taxes. It identifies the taxes for which you are responsible and provides your Illinois Account ID or License Number.
